Choose to Rejoice
09/05/2021 Duración: 36minAs we have been seeing one of the major themes throughout this book is joy, or rejoicing. I have said that we are to rejoice in spite of our circumstances. We need to find our joy in Christ not in the circumstances. The Christian life is to be one of joy, a joy that transcends the negative things in life. I believe Paul lived this out very well, as his circumstances were bleak. Paul was under house arrest chained to a Roman guard and yet he viewed his circumstances as an opportunity to rejoice. Paul’s mindset on choosing to rejoice even in the midst of his circumstances allowed him to not only be content, but also joyful, even when circumstances were tough. And this is what Scripture calls us to do as well. Choose to rejoice.

Missions Moments Nueva Esperanza
25/04/2021 Duración: 34minOne of our missionaries that we support Carlos and Barbara Barahona with Nueva Esperanza (New Hope) gave an update and spoke for us. Carlos and Barbara started the work in Honduras and have been there for 29 years. The ministry seeks to affect permanent change in the spiritual, emotional, mental, and physical lives of poor children living in Honduras. Children are given daily care and attention along with being taught biblical values, personal hygiene, and life skills.
